Title of Rule: WAC 296-400A-045 What fees will I have to pay?

Purpose: To reduce fees that were raised in excess of amount allowed by [Initiative} 601.

Statutory Authority for Adoption: RCW 34.05.356 (1)(f).

Statute Being Implemented: RCW 18.106.125.

Summary: Current rule includes four plumber fees which were inadvertently increased beyond the 4.05% allowed.

Reasons Supporting Proposal: To comply with [Initiative] 601 requirements, the department is proposing to reduce the fees to the allowable amount.

Name of Agency Personnel Responsible for Drafting: Kevin Morris, Tumwater, 902-5578; Implementation and Enforcement: Patrick Woods, Tumwater, 902-6348.

Name of Proponent: Department of Labor and Industries, governmental.

Rule is not necessitated by federal law, federal or state court decision.

Explanation of Rule, its Purpose, and Anticipated Effects: The proposed amendment reduces fees in WAC 296-400A-045 to correct changes which resulted in fee increases in excess of the 4.05% allowed by [Initiative] 601 limits.

Proposal Changes the Following Existing Rules: The proposed amendment lowers four plumber fees to the 4.05% allowed.

WAC 296-400A-045  What fees will I have to pay? The following are the department's plumbers fees:



Type of Fee Period Covered by Fee Dollar Amount of Fee
Examination application Per examination $ 108.25
Reciprocity application Per application $ 108.25
Trainee certificate.* One year $ 32.50
Trainee certificate Less than one year $3.00 per month with a minimum fee of $21.50
Temporary permit 90 days $ ((54.25)) 54.00
Journeyman or specialty certificate.*.* Two years $ ((87.00)) 86.75
Journeyman or specialty certificate Less than two years $3.50 per month with a minimum fee of $((32.75)) 32.50
Medical gas endorsement

examination application.*.*.*

Per application $40.00
Medical gas endorsement.*.* One year $30.00
Medical gas endorsement Less than one year $2.50 per month with a minimum fee of $17.50
Medical gas endorsement examination fee.*.*.* See note below.
Medical gas endorsement training course fee.*.*.*.* See note below.
Reinstatement of a journeyman certificate $ ((174.00)) 173.50
Replacement of all certificates $ 32.50

.* The trainee certificate shall expire one year from the date of issuance and be renewed on or before the date of expiration.



.*.* This fee applies to either the original issuance or a renewal of a certificate. If you have passed the plumbers certificate of competency examination or the medical gas piping installer endorsement examination and paid the certificate fee, you will be issued a plumber certificate of competency or a medical gas endorsement that will expire on your birthdate.



The annual renewal of a Medical Gas Piping Installer Endorsement shall include a continuity affidavit verifying that brazing work has been performed within the past year.



.*.*.* This fee is paid directly to a nationally recognized testing agency under contract with the department. It covers the cost of preparing and administering the written competency examination and the materials necessary to conduct the practical competency examination required for the medical gas piping system installers endorsement. This fee is not paid to the department.



.*.*.*.* This fee is paid directly to a training course provider approved by the department, in consultation with the state advisory board of plumbers. It covers the cost of providing training courses required for the medical gas piping system installer endorsement. This fee is not paid to the department.



If your birth year is:

(1) In an even-numbered year, your certificate will expire on your birthdate in the next even-numbered year.

(2) In an odd-numbered year, your certificate will expire on your birthdate in the next odd-numbered year.
